FACTBOX-Security developments in Iraq, Aug 16
Source: Reuters
Aug 16 (Reuters) - Following are security developments in Iraq at 1330 GMT on Saturday. BAGHDAD - A bomb placed in a parked car killed six religious pilgirms and wounded ten others in the Ur district of northeastern Baghdad, police said. ISKANDARIYA - Police arrested 12 people suspected of involvement in an attack this week on pilgrims in Iskandariya, 40 km (25 miles) south of Baghdad, police said. MAYSAN PROVINCE - Iraqi forces killed three suspected insurgents, captured one other, and confiscated several mortar bombs in the Salam district of the southeastern Maysan province, the Defence Ministry said. They also discovered what the ministry described as an insurgent headquarters in another area of Maysan province, which contained weapons, maps, tapes and other intelligence related to the movements of an Iraqi army unit.
